Fat Sand Rat vs Pied Tamarin
Psammomys obesus compared with Saguinus bicolor
Key Differences
- Fat Sand Rat is Least Concern while Pied Tamarin is Critically Endangered.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Fat Sand Rat | Pied Tamarin |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Callitrichidae |
| Genus | Psammomys | Saguinus |
| Species | Psammomys obesus | Saguinus bicolor |
Evolutionary Relationship
Fat Sand Rat and Pied Tamarin share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
